Ergonomic Considerations: Comfort Over Time

Prolonged screen time demands thoughtful ergonomics. Poor posture or awkward viewing angles contribute to eye strain, neck pain, and reduced concentration—common issues among digital creatives. How each setup affects physical comfort plays a major role in long-term usability.

Ultrawide monitors typically feature a single, continuous display, often with a gentle curve (e.g., 1500R or 1800R curvature). This design reduces head movement by bringing all content within a natural field of view. Since everything is centered in front of the user, there’s less need to turn the head from side to side, minimizing cervical strain.

In contrast, dual-monitor setups require users to shift their gaze—and often their heads—between two distinct panels. Even when aligned properly, this lateral motion accumulates over hours, potentially leading to discomfort. However, modern articulating arms allow precise positioning, enabling users to angle both screens inward slightly, mimicking a wraparound effect that mitigates some of the ergonomic downsides.

Tip: Position the center of your primary display at or just below eye level, about an arm's length away, regardless of whether you use one or two screens.

Another factor is bezel interference. Dual screens introduce a physical gap—a bezel—right where your eyes naturally travel. For tasks like scrolling through timelines in Adobe Premiere or moving elements across artboards in Figma, crossing that central divide disrupts flow. Ultrawides eliminate this barrier entirely, offering uninterrupted visual continuity.

Workflow Efficiency: Real-World Performance for Designers

Designers juggle multiple applications simultaneously: Photoshop on one side, Illustrator references on another, communication tools like Slack or email running in the background. Both ultrawide and dual-screen configurations aim to support multitasking, but they do so differently.

A 34-inch ultrawide (3440x1440 resolution) provides a vast horizontal canvas ideal for timeline-based work such as video editing, animation, or music production. Applications like DaVinci Resolve or After Effects benefit immensely from having extended timelines visible without constant horizontal scrolling. Similarly, web designers preview responsive layouts side-by-side with code editors, all within a single fluid space.

Dual monitors offer greater configurability. You might dedicate one screen exclusively to your main design application (e.g., Sketch), keep reference images and mood boards open on the second, and run meetings via Zoom tucked into a corner. Each screen operates independently, allowing different scaling settings, orientations (portrait vs. landscape), and even input sources—useful if connecting a laptop and desktop simultaneously.

“With dual monitors, I can isolate distractions. My left screen is strictly for creation; my right handles research and feedback. It creates mental zones.” — Lena Torres, Senior UX Designer at Studio Nova

However, window management becomes trickier with dual screens. Dragging a file from one monitor to another may trigger unintended full-screen transitions or misaligned snapping behaviors, especially in older operating systems. macOS has improved Spaces and Mission Control, but Windows still struggles with inconsistent DPI scaling across displays, causing blurry text or awkward resizing.

Technical Comparison: Resolution, Aspect Ratio, and Hardware Needs

Understanding the technical specs behind both setups clarifies their functional limits. Below is a direct comparison of typical configurations used by professional designers.

Feature Ultrawide Monitor (34\") Dual Screen Setup (2 x 27\")
Total Resolution 3440x1440 (UWQHD) 5120x1440 (combined)
Aspect Ratio 21:9 16:9 per screen
Bezels Between Work Areas None One thick vertical gap
GPU Requirements Moderate (single high-res output) Higher (dual outputs, possible daisy-chaining)
OS Window Management Simpler (one display zone) Complex (multiple virtual desktops)
Cost (approx.) $600–$1,000 $800–$1,600 + mount
Calibration Consistency Uniform color across screen Variation likely between units

Note that while dual screens technically offer more total pixels horizontally, much of that space is fragmented. An ultrawide delivers a cohesive workspace optimized for linear workflows. Also, color accuracy matters greatly in design. Calibrating two separate monitors to match perfectly requires time and hardware calibration tools. Even minor discrepancies in brightness or white point can mislead design decisions.

Additionally, ultrawides reduce cable clutter—one DisplayPort or HDMI connection versus two—and simplify desk organization. Fewer devices also mean fewer points of failure and easier troubleshooting.

Real-World Example: A Freelance Illustrator’s Transition

Ravi Mehta, a freelance concept artist based in Bangalore, switched from a dual 27-inch monitor setup to a single 38-inch ultrawide after six years of using twins. His workflow involved heavy use of Clip Studio Paint, reference image browsing, and client calls via Google Meet.

Initially skeptical, Ravi found that dragging thumbnails across the bezel during sketching disrupted his rhythm. He also spent extra time adjusting window positions due to mismatched scaling between his older secondary monitor and new primary. After adopting the ultrawide, he arranged his workspace into three virtual zones: left for references, center for canvas, and right for chat and email. Using built-in software like DisplayFusion (Windows) or BetterSnapTool (macOS), he automated window placement with keyboard shortcuts.

“The biggest win was immersion,” Ravi said. “I stopped noticing the edges of the screen. Scrolling through long character sheets feels cinematic now. And no more losing my cursor in the middle black hole.”

He did note one drawback: rotating the display vertically wasn’t feasible without specialized mounting. For tall illustrations or storyboarding, he occasionally missed the portrait-mode flexibility of a second upright monitor.

Actionable Checklist Before Choosing Your Setup

Before making a purchase, evaluate your current and future workflow needs. Use this checklist to guide your decision:

  • Assess your primary design tools: Do they benefit from wide timelines (favoring ultrawide) or split-reference layouts (favoring dual)?
  • Check GPU capabilities: Can your graphics card drive an ultrawide at full resolution with smooth performance?
  • Measure your desk space: Ultrawides need depth; dual monitors require width. Ensure clearance for comfortable viewing.
  • Consider portability: If you move between home and studio, a single monitor is easier to transport and reconfigure.
  • Test color consistency: If using dual screens, plan to calibrate both regularly with a hardware probe.
  • Budget for accessories: Include costs for mounts, cables, and calibration tools in your total estimate.
  • Try before you buy: Visit a retail store or borrow a demo unit to experience the feel of each setup firsthand.

Frequently Asked Questions

Can I use an ultrawide monitor for coding alongside design work?

Absolutely. Many developers and full-stack designers prefer ultrawides because they can dock their IDE, browser, terminal, and design tool side-by-side without switching contexts. The 21:9 aspect ratio mimics reading a wide document, improving readability and reducing vertical scrolling.

Is screen burn-in a concern with ultrawides?

Modern ultrawide OLED and LED panels are less prone to permanent burn-in, but static elements (like dock bars or tool palettes) displayed for extended periods can cause temporary image retention. To prevent this, enable screen savers, use dark mode interfaces, and vary your layout periodically.

Can I daisy-chain two monitors from one ultrawide port?

Some ultrawides support Multi-Stream Transport (MST) over DisplayPort, allowing daisy-chaining additional monitors. However, this depends on GPU support and bandwidth. For critical design work, avoid daisy-chaining to maintain consistent refresh rates and avoid latency.

Final Recommendation: Match the Tool to the Task

There is no universal winner in the ultrawide vs. dual-screen debate. The best choice hinges on individual working patterns, software preferences, and physical environment.

Choose an **ultrawide monitor** if:

  • You value immersive, distraction-free focus.
  • Your work involves timelines, long documents, or panoramic previews.
  • You want simpler cabling, easier calibration, and reduced desk clutter.
  • You frequently present work to clients and appreciate seamless visuals.

Opt for a **dual-screen setup** if:

  • You need maximum screen area with flexible orientation options.
  • You work across vastly different applications that benefit from isolation (e.g., design + accounting).
  • You already own compatible monitors and want to upgrade incrementally.
  • You collaborate remotely and keep video calls permanently visible on a secondary screen.

Hybrid solutions are emerging too. Some designers pair a 27-inch 4K monitor with a vertical secondary panel, combining the precision of a high-PPI primary with the organizational power of a narrow reference screen. Others use ultrawides as their base and add a small tablet or secondary device for notifications.
